2017-03-21 2 views
1

Wenn Sie auf das Bild schauen, werden Sie eine Reihe von Variablen im Bereich auf der rechten Seite sehen, die nicht definiert sind. Selbst wenn ich um die Variable "page" schwebe, heißt es undefined. Aber dann rechts davon siehst du auch:Chrome Debugger zeigt undefined aber es gibt wirklich einen Wert

page = Object {controlNode: Object, id: 149... etc etc} 

Warum passiert das und wie kann ich das beheben? Danke

enter image description here

+0

Sie können einen Fehlerbericht unter https://crbug.com einreichen. Anscheinend wurde es noch nicht wie einige andere Anwendungsfälle für let/const implementiert, zum Beispiel https://crbug.com/681333 – wOxxOm

Antwort

2

Sie Konsole durch Drücken Esc öffnen. Geben Sie dann page in die Konsole ein. Wenn es wirklich Wert hat, wird der Wert im Konsolenfenster angezeigt.

Wenn nicht arbeiten, versuchen Sie page zu Uhr Liste hinzufügen, die im rechten Bereich des Chrome-Debugger ist.

+0

ich gerade versucht und es sagt undefined. ty für Ihre Eingabe – user1189352

+0

Warum würde es angezeigt werden, wenn es nicht im globalen Geltungsbereich ist? –

+0

@ user1189352 Sind Sie im Debugging-Modus, wenn Sie dies versuchen, und Ihr Breakpoint trifft die Zeile als Bild in Ihrer Frage? –

Verwandte Themen